Online Proofreading Jobs for Freelance Proofreaders

Proofreading is the method of checking any form of literature for its grammatical and punctuation errors. It is that stage of putting any literary form into its finality for end-use, whereby the copy can be considered to be perfect. The person who looks into the proofreading task is known as a proofreader.

How to be a proofreader : While there are no certified courses as such to qualify as a proofreader, yet there are varied online courses and tutorials that provide training for aspiring proofreaders. Despite that, a question that normally arises is how to become a proofreader. The answer to this is simple, practice grammar and punctuation exercise, learn as many spellings and gain knowledge on as many subjects as possible.

Proofreading software : There are certain proofreading software that have been developed to recognize grammatical, spelling and punctuation errors, and correct them. One needs to simply install the software and if required, set it to auto correct to correct errors automatically. The other option is to let the software mark the errors and at the end the person can manually correct it by moving the cursor onto the marked word or area.

List of Companies and Websites that Hire Proofreaders:
·         Proofread NOW: From time to time, they seek English, Spanish, Russian, Japanese, and Chinese proofreaders. If you have a keen eye for accurate, clearly written business communications then check out this website.
·         Wordfirm: Work as an independent contractor. This website has hundreds of freelancers who  work from their home office through the Internet, so location is not a factor.
·         Editfast: They require skilled proofreaders, editors and freelance writers. EditFast provides a free service to freelance editors. There are promotional tools provided to help the activated editors promote their free Web pages and their skills and talents as editors.
·         Cyberedit: Provides editing , writing, and marketing services. You receive your jobs via email and can work from your own computer and set your own hours. You are paid per completed editing job that you accept.
·         Rowman & Littlefield Publishing Group: They need freelance proofreaders and copyeditors. To be considered for proofreading and copyediting work at RLPG, all freelancers must take our standard tests and have email; proofreaders must be able to print out a booklength set of page proofs on their printers.
·         Wordfirm: Seeks qualified freelance writers, editors, copyeditors, and proofreaders. You must be completely equipped for handling work through the internet. They are only interested in professional, highly skilled writers and editors with at least three years of practical experience.
·         Mulberry Studio: Full-time and part-time transcription and proofreading positions are available either on-site, in their Harvard Square office, or on a freelance contractual basis from your home. To be considered, you need to have: A typing speed of 75 wpm, Excellent grammar and language skills, Experience in transcription and word processing, A minimum of 2 years experience.
